      <title>CSS Custom Properties</title>
      <dc:creator>Jennifer Fadriquela</dc:creator>
      <pubDate>Sat, 29 May 2021 00:53:24 +0000</pubDate>
      <link>https://dev.to/jengfad/css-custom-properties-3n8a</link>
      <guid>https://dev.to/jengfad/css-custom-properties-3n8a</guid>
      <description>&lt;p&gt;I've been working on a Razor project and was finding a way to dynamically assign style values to &lt;code&gt;::before&lt;/code&gt; elements. Best way to do this is via &lt;a href="https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/CSS/Using_CSS_custom_properties"&gt;CSS Custom Properties&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Here's what I came up with Razor code: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;css&lt;br&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ight plaintext"&gt;&lt;code&gt;.wrapper::before {
  background-color: var(--label-color);
  content: var(--label-text);
}
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;p&gt;razor&lt;br&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ight plaintext"&gt;&lt;code&gt;@{
  var labelText = "Some Label";
  var labelColor = "blue";
}
&amp;lt;div class="wrapper" style="--label-color: @labelColor; --label-text: '@labelText'"&amp;gt;
  Hello
&amp;lt;/div&amp;gt;
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;

      <title>Angular Prod Build Specific Bugs</title>
      <dc:creator>Jennifer Fadriquela</dc:creator>
      <pubDate>Fri, 20 Nov 2020 01:55:42 +0000</pubDate>
      <link>https://dev.to/jengfad/angular-prod-build-specific-bugs-3pga</link>
      <guid>https://dev.to/jengfad/angular-prod-build-specific-bugs-3pga</guid>
      <description>&lt;p&gt;I recently upgraded our project to Angular 10 from version 8. Below is a piece of code that went buggy:&lt;br&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ight plaintext"&gt;&lt;code&gt;@ViewChild('searchTextBox', { read: false }) searchTextBox: ElementRef;
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;p&gt;This was working in v8 but not in v10. &l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The fix is to assign the expected type to 'read' property.&lt;br&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ight plaintext"&gt;&lt;code&gt;@ViewChild('searchTextBox', { read: ElementRef }) searchTextBox: ElementRef;
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;p&gt;As I am debugging this in v10, I noticed that the error is not reproducible when running &lt;code&gt;ng serve&lt;/code&gt; but will appear if you run &lt;code&gt;ng serve --prod&lt;/code&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Lesson Learned: Always do a sanity test in prod build. Note that prod build is not debuggable and takes a while to build.&lt;/p&gt;

      <title>ESLint + Prettifier VSCode Lean Setup</title>
      <dc:creator>Jennifer Fadriquela</dc:creator>
      <pubDate>Fri, 30 Oct 2020 05:53:00 +0000</pubDate>
      <link>https://dev.to/jengfad/eslint-prettifier-vscode-lean-setup-50c</link>
      <guid>https://dev.to/jengfad/eslint-prettifier-vscode-lean-setup-50c</guid>
      <description>&lt;p&gt;A basic VSCode setup of ESLint + Prettifier that includes configuration for automatic linting/fixing upon filesave. I listed out steps from khalilstemmler's articles about &lt;a href="https://khalilstemmler.com/blogs/typescript/eslint-for-typescript/"&gt;ESLint&lt;/a&gt; and &lt;a href="https://khalilstemmler.com/blogs/tooling/prettier/"&gt;Prettier&lt;/a&gt; integration to Typescript and merged them to a compact setup.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Install lint and other lint plugins via npm cli
&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ight plaintext"&gt;&lt;code&gt;npm install --save-dev eslint @typescript-eslint/parser @typescript-eslint/eslint-plugin
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Create &lt;code&gt;.eslintrc&lt;/code&gt; from root directory with contents:
&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ight json"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;{&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"root"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="kc"&gt;true&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"parser"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s2"&gt;"@typescript-eslint/parser"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"plugins"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;[&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
    &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s2"&gt;"@typescript-eslint"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;],&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"extends"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;[&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
    &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s2"&gt;"eslint:recommended"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
    &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s2"&gt;"plugin:@typescript-eslint/eslint-recommended"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
    &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s2"&gt;"plugin:@typescript-eslint/recommended"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;],&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"rules"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;{&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;}&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;}&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Create &lt;code&gt;.eslintignore&lt;/code&gt; from root directory with contents:
&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ight plaintext"&gt;&lt;code&gt;node_modules
dist
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;(Optional) Add eslint script to &lt;code&gt;package.json&lt;/code&gt;. This enables you to execute lint script on npm cli.
&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ight json"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;{&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"scripts"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;{&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
    &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;...&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
    &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"lint"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s2"&gt;"eslint . --ext .ts"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;}&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;}&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;p&gt;Run in cli: &lt;code&gt;npm run lint&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Install prettier via npm cli
&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ight plaintext"&gt;&lt;code&gt;npm install --save-dev prettier
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Create &lt;code&gt;.prettierrc&lt;/code&gt; on root directory with contents:
&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ight json"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;{&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"semi"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="kc"&gt;true&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"trailingComma"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s2"&gt;"none"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"singleQuote"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="kc"&gt;true&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"printWidth"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="mi"&gt;80&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;}&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;(Optional) Add prettier script to &lt;code&gt;package.json&lt;/code&gt;.
&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ight json"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;{&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"scripts"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;{&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
    &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;...&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
    &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"prettier-format"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s2"&gt;"prettier --config .prettierrc 'src/**/*.ts' --write"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;}&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;}&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;p&gt;Run in cli: &lt;code&gt;npm run prettier-format&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Install Prettier and Eslint from VSCode Extensions &lt;code&gt;Ctrl + Shift + X&lt;/code&gt;.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--2KOjCcXJ--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/0895sp7gyfumil6d1j17.JPG" class="article-body-image-wrapper"&gt;&lt;img src="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--2KOjCcXJ--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/0895sp7gyfumil6d1j17.JPG" alt="Alt Text"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;a href="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--zcKXYAKT--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/ij23ug2vilx1pfuv7sk3.JPG" class="article-body-image-wrapper"&gt;&lt;img src="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--zcKXYAKT--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/ij23ug2vilx1pfuv7sk3.JPG" alt="Alt Text"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Set the defaults via &lt;code&gt;CTRL + Shift + P&lt;/code&gt; then select &lt;code&gt;Preferences: Open Settings (JSON)&lt;/code&gt;
&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--XuhBrw4b--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/la7ie7ylrk6llcn0u8rk.JPG" class="article-body-image-wrapper"&gt;&lt;img src="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--XuhBrw4b--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/la7ie7ylrk6llcn0u8rk.JPG" alt="Alt Text"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Add below configuration (if not yet existing)
&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ight json"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;//&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;Default&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;(format&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;when&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;you&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;paste)&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"editor.formatOnPaste"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="kc"&gt;true&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;//&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;Default&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;(format&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;when&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;you&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;save)&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nl"&gt;"editor.formatOnSave"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;:&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="kc"&gt;true&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="err"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="w"&gt;
&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;p&gt;You can now either run the scripts via cli or choose to lint every time you save changes on your code.&lt;/p&gt;

      <title>Audio Levels Troubleshooting</title>
      <dc:creator>Jennifer Fadriquela</dc:creator>
      <pubDate>Mon, 26 Oct 2020 04:29:34 +0000</pubDate>
      <link>https://dev.to/jengfad/audio-levels-troubleshooting-40c7</link>
      <guid>https://dev.to/jengfad/audio-levels-troubleshooting-40c7</guid>
      <description>&lt;p&gt;For the longest time, I thought my laptop audio jack was broken. Whenever I plug any type of earphones, the left bud is somewhat muted or not audible. I was on the verge of purchasing a USB audio adapter but thankfully did not push through with it.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The fix: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Search 'Sound' on Window Search&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;On 'Playback' tab, select 'Speakers/Headphones (Realtek Audio)' then click 'Properties'.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Go to 'Levels' tab and click 'Balance'&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Adjust the left and right volume.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--nAY7tGL4--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/sv8hilbvwk74t1g361nr.JPG" class="article-body-image-wrapper"&gt;&lt;img src="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--nAY7tGL4--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/sv8hilbvwk74t1g361nr.JPG" alt="Alt Text"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;As it turns out, my left audio was in a super low volume all this time.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Lesson Learned: Explore Control Panel first before compulsively adding something to cart.&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

      <title>Webscraping: Beginner's Thoughts</title>
      <dc:creator>Jennifer Fadriquela</dc:creator>
      <pubDate>Sat, 22 Aug 2020 01:15:19 +0000</pubDate>
      <link>https://dev.to/jengfad/webscraping-beginner-s-thoughts-15cn</link>
      <guid>https://dev.to/jengfad/webscraping-beginner-s-thoughts-15cn</guid>
      <description>&lt;p&gt;Decided to learn webscraping this month. The first thing I did was to watch courses in Pluralsight:&lt;br&gt;
&lt;a href="https://app.pluralsight.com/library/courses/scraping-dynamic-web-pages-python-selenium/table-of-contents"&gt;Scraping Dynamic Web Pages with Python and Selenium&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br&gt;
&lt;a href="https://app.pluralsight.com/library/courses/scraping-first-web-page-python/table-of-contents"&gt;Scraping Your First Web Page with Python&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br&gt;
&lt;a href="https://app.pluralsight.com/library/courses/exploring-web-scraping-python/table-of-contents"&gt;Exploring Web Scraping with Python&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Webscraping can be done by using Python libraries like &lt;strong&gt;BeautifulSoup&lt;/strong&gt; and &lt;strong&gt;Requests&lt;/strong&gt;. This assumes that you have all urls predetermined and will just scrape the page source. &l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;But if you will scrape a dynamic page (ex: a div is rendered only if a specific button was clicked) then you will need a library like &lt;strong&gt;Selenium&lt;/strong&gt; to emulate user interactions.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;When I was confident with the basics, I took a step further and learned the &lt;strong&gt;Scrapy&lt;/strong&gt; framework. This requires a steeper learning curve than native Python libraries because you have to know the flow of how objects are passed in the framework. The main advantage is you won't have to write boilerplate codes (writing data to files, handling url requests, data modelling) redundantly because those are already integrated with its pipeline.&lt;/p&gt;

      <title>Escape SQL LIKE wildcard characters</title>
      <dc:creator>Jennifer Fadriquela</dc:creator>
      <pubDate>Fri, 26 Jun 2020 11:38:33 +0000</pubDate>
      <link>https://dev.to/jengfad/escape-sql-like-wildcard-characters-hh</link>
      <guid>https://dev.to/jengfad/escape-sql-like-wildcard-characters-hh</guid>
      <description>&lt;p&gt;In MSSQL, &lt;a href="https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/sql/t-sql/language-elements/like-transact-sql?view=sql-server-ver15"&gt;LIKE&lt;/a&gt; operator has wildcard characters that aids in pattern matching.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;If you want to disable it, one way is to manually escape it. In my case, I made a string extension to transform the search text before passing it to the stored procedure via ADO.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;SQL recognizes which character to escape if it was enclosed in &lt;code&gt;[]&lt;/code&gt; with the exemption of single quote &lt;code&gt;'&lt;/code&gt;.&lt;br&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ight csharp"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="k"&gt;public&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="k"&gt;static&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="kt"&gt;string&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="nf"&gt;EscapeSqlChars&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;(&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="k"&gt;this&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="kt"&gt;string&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="n"&gt;input&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;)&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;span class="p"&gt;{&lt;/span&gt;
    &lt;span class="k"&gt;return&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="n"&gt;input&lt;/span&gt;
        &lt;span class="p"&gt;.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nf"&gt;Replace&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;(&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;@"["&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="s"&gt;@"[[]"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;)&lt;/span&gt;
        &lt;span class="p"&gt;.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nf"&gt;Replace&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;(&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;@"\"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="s"&gt;@"[\]"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;)&lt;/span&gt;
        &lt;span class="p"&gt;.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nf"&gt;Replace&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;(&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;@"'"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="s"&gt;@"''"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;)&lt;/span&gt;
        &lt;span class="p"&gt;.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nf"&gt;Replace&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;(&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;@"%"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="s"&gt;@"[%]"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;)&lt;/span&gt;
        &lt;span class="p"&gt;.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nf"&gt;Replace&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;(&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;@"_"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;,&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="s"&gt;@"[_]"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="p"&gt;);&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;span class="p"&gt;}&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;

      <title>Angular 9 Upgrade - Thoughts</title>
      <dc:creator>Jennifer Fadriquela</dc:creator>
      <pubDate>Mon, 01 Jun 2020 12:56:14 +0000</pubDate>
      <link>https://dev.to/jengfad/angular-9-upgrade-thoughts-5ch9</link>
      <guid>https://dev.to/jengfad/angular-9-upgrade-thoughts-5ch9</guid>
      <description>&lt;p&gt;I got to upgrade one of our Angular projects from v8.3.23 to latest v9. Just like my previous experience, I used Angular's &lt;a href="https://update.angular.io/#8.2:9.0l3"&gt;update guide&lt;/a&gt; which will list out all details specific to the source version.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;blockquote&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Note&lt;/strong&gt;: Angular will not proceed to execute &lt;code&gt;ng update&lt;/code&gt; if there are pending commits on your branch.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;/blockquote&gt;

&lt;h1&gt;
  
  
  Before
&lt;/h1&gt;

&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;Since the project uses lazy loaded modules, I had to update all &lt;a href="https://angular.io/guide/deprecations#loadchildren-string-syntax"&gt;module string import to dynamic import&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;Upgraded angular cli/core from v8.3.23 to v8.3.26&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;h1&gt;
  
  
  During
&lt;/h1&gt;

&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;When I encountered the error &lt;code&gt;× Migration failed: Incompatible peer dependencies found.&lt;/code&gt;, I just followed the suggestion stated on the error message and ran the &lt;code&gt;ng-update&lt;/code&gt; with &lt;code&gt;--force&lt;/code&gt; parameter. It should look like: &lt;code&gt;ng update @angular/core @angular/cli --force&lt;/code&gt;
&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;h1&gt;
  
  
  After
&lt;/h1&gt;

&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;Removed deprecated &lt;code&gt;entryComponents&lt;/code&gt; from modules.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;Ran &lt;code&gt;ng add @angular/localize&lt;/code&gt; since we used &lt;code&gt;ngx-translate&lt;/code&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;Removed static text on &lt;code&gt;ngx-translate&lt;/code&gt; elements.&lt;br&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ight html"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="c"&gt;&amp;lt;!-- OLD --&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;span&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="na"&gt;translate=&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;"Profile.Save"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;Save&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;/span&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;

&lt;span class="c"&gt;&amp;lt;!-- NEW--&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;span&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="na"&gt;translate=&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;"Profile.Save"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/span&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;Removed &lt;code&gt;{ read: false }&lt;/code&gt; params for &lt;code&gt;@ViewChild&lt;/code&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;For dynamic components, I had to place &lt;code&gt;&amp;lt;template&amp;gt;&lt;/code&gt; inside a div to prevent them in appending at bottom of parent div.&lt;br&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ight html"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="c"&gt;&amp;lt;!-- OLD --&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="na"&gt;class=&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;"parent"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
   &l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;Sibling 1&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
   &l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;template&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="na"&gt;#host&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/template&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
   &l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;Sibling 2&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;

&lt;span class="c"&gt;&amp;lt;!-- NEW --&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="na"&gt;class=&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;"parent"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
   &l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;Sibling 1&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
   &l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
      &l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;template&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="na"&gt;#host&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/template&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
   &l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;/div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
   &l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;Sibling 2&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;h2&gt;
  
  
  ngx-charts
&lt;/h2&gt;

&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;Ran &lt;code&gt;ng update @swimlane/ngx-charts&lt;/code&gt;. This will also update &lt;code&gt;@angular/cdk&lt;/code&gt; &l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;The upgrade will remove &lt;code&gt;d3&lt;/code&gt; folder from &lt;code&gt;node-modules&lt;/code&gt;. All references to &lt;code&gt;d3&lt;/code&gt; will have an error.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;Ran &lt;code&gt;npm install d3 --save&lt;/code&gt; and &lt;code&gt;npm install @types/d3 --save-dev&lt;/code&gt; to fix &lt;code&gt;d3&lt;/code&gt; references errors&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;p&gt;Updated reference from &lt;code&gt;@swimlane/ngx-charts/release&lt;/code&gt; to &lt;code&gt;@swimlane/ngx-charts&lt;/code&gt; on imports.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;

&lt;h1&gt;
  
  
  Final Thoughts
&lt;/h1&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Don't forget to &lt;code&gt;ng build --prod&lt;/code&gt; to ensure safe build.&lt;br&gt;
In summary, upgrading our project to version 9 is straightforward if you don't have conflicting packages. &lt;code&gt;ng update&lt;/code&gt; had been helpful in updating deprecated items from older versions. My experience may not be the same with others that have larger projects or have too many package dependencies.&lt;/p&gt;

      <title>Angular i18n  Markup Collision</title>
      <dc:creator>Jennifer Fadriquela</dc:creator>
      <pubDate>Sat, 30 May 2020 22:50:23 +0000</pubDate>
      <link>https://dev.to/jengfad/angular-s-i18n-markup-collision-481l</link>
      <guid>https://dev.to/jengfad/angular-s-i18n-markup-collision-481l</guid>
      <description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="https://angular.io/guide/i18n"&gt;i18n&lt;/a&gt; is tightly coupled with HTML markup. I had a couple of issue wherein Dev-A edited the markup then Dev-B triggered translation scripts. Dev-B was confused because there are translation items modified but don't belong to his intended changes.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;h4&gt;
  
  
  Issue A - Newline formatting
&lt;/h4&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Original Content&lt;br&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ight html"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="na"&gt;class=&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;"login-alert"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="na"&gt;i18n=&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;"Login Page|Validation message"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;Password is required.&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;/div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;p&gt;Modified Content (for some IDEs, they autoformat newlines)&lt;br&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ight html"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="na"&gt;class=&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;"login-alert"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="na"&gt;i18n=&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;"Login Page|Validation message"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
   Password is required.
&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;/div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;p&gt;Notice that &lt;code&gt;Password is required&lt;/code&gt; is now on its own line. Once we run &lt;code&gt;i18n-extract&lt;/code&gt;, it will generate a new hash id for this item.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--io3r3IWM--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/ulsvypgxk7uvzi3n4gnp.PNG" class="article-body-image-wrapper"&gt;&lt;img src="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--io3r3IWM--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/ulsvypgxk7uvzi3n4gnp.PNG" alt="Alt Text"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;h4&gt;
  
  
  Issue B - Changes on text content
&lt;/h4&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Taking the same item on A, let's remove the "." then run &lt;code&gt;i18n-extract&lt;/code&gt;.&lt;br&gt;
&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div class="highlight js-code-highlight"&gt;
&lt;pre class="highlight html"&gt;&lt;code&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;div&lt;/span&gt; &lt;span class="na"&gt;class=&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;"login-alert"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="na"&gt;i18n=&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="s"&gt;"Login Page|Validation message"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;Password is required&lt;span class="nt"&gt;&amp;lt;/div&amp;gt;&lt;/span&gt;
&lt;/code&gt;&lt;/pre&gt;

&lt;/div&gt;



&lt;p&gt;It generated a new hash id for the above changes.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--lS7IKGWI--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/t8nbo8qi1d1jy1l4voro.PNG" class="article-body-image-wrapper"&gt;&lt;img src="https://res.cloudinary.com/practicaldev/image/fetch/s--lS7IKGWI--/c_limit%2Cf_auto%2Cfl_progressive%2Cq_auto%2Cw_880/https://dev-to-uploads.s3.amazonaws.com/i/t8nbo8qi1d1jy1l4voro.PNG" alt="Alt Text"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;h3&gt;
  
  
  Workaround
&lt;/h3&gt;

&lt;p&gt;I created a console application in C# that will format xlf files and ignore whitespace changes. This will execute &lt;code&gt;i18n-extract&lt;/code&gt; and proceed on processing xlf files. Running this tool will prevent new hash id creation. Here is the &lt;a href="https://github.com/jengfad/angular-i18n-xlf-formatter"&gt;source code&lt;/a&gt;. &lt;/p&gt;

&lt;h3&gt;
  
  
  Conclusion
&lt;/h3&gt;

&lt;p&gt;With this in mind, we should always check our changes if affected existing translation items by running &lt;code&gt;i18n-extract&lt;/code&gt; before pushing it.&lt;/p&gt;
